📖 About Danilovgrad

Danilovgrad is a town in central Montenegro.

It has a population of 6,852, according to the 2011 census.

It is situated in the Danilovgrad Municipality which lies along the main route between Montenegro's two largest cities, Podgorica and Nikšić. Via villages, Danilovgrad forms part of a conurbation with Podgorica.
